garycarla Posted August 25, 2007 #7 Share Posted August 25, 2007 Hard to say what it's worth to you. I say that because some people pay FULL PRICE for an AC and would not bother with anything less. There are many many others that only book inside cabins and would not even pay $100 to go to an oceanview. It all comes down to what value you put on the extra sq footage and perks. Some people would gladly spend the money. Others would not. There are some on these boards that would always say "go for the penthouse/suite". In reality, very few do. If you look at the number of penthouse or full suites on the ship and the fact that there are not sold out, it means most people have decided the money is not worth it. Personally, if I could get it at a discount I would go for it. As to what perks you get and some more info, do a search on penthouse or suite.
